ULI Appoints Industry Leaders to Global Board of Directors, Global Trustees, and Regional Executive Committees

National -

WASHINGTON – RealEstateRama – More than 50 real estate leaders joined or were reappointed to the Urban Land Institute’s (ULI) Global Board of Directors, Global Trustees, and regional executive committees to serve terms that began July 1.

“This global collection of real estate leaders consists of representatives from across the industry and supports ULI in its continued effort to shape the future of the built environment for transformative impact in communities worldwide,” ULI Global CEO Angela Cain said. “ULI members are the cornerstone of the organization. Their dedication and shared expertise are what allows us to get standards of excellence for the industry.”

“These appointments bring together an exceptional group of leaders whose experience and perspectives will help shape ULI’s work in the year ahead,” ULI Global Chair Franz Colloredo-Mansfeld said. “Each of these individuals has demonstrated a strong commitment to the real estate industry and the built environment, and we are fortunate to have their leadership across the organization. I look forward to working with them as we continue to support our members, strengthen our communities, and advance ULI’s mission globally.”

Global Board of Directors

Newly appointed members of the Global Board of Directors:

  • Edward Siskind, Europe Chair
  • Matt Boker, Member Networks Chair
  • Kelli Lawrence, District Council Chair

ULI operates under the direction of its Global Board of Directors, which is the principal policy-making body of the Institute and is responsible for managing the property, affairs, and strategic direction of the organization and for oversight of all fiscal, management, and legal operations and activities. At-large directors are nominated by the Global Nominations and Governance Committee and subsequently elected to two-year terms by the Global Board of Directors. The Global Trustees represent ULI’s global membership. They help navigate the organization in execution of its mission. They are nominated by the Global Board of Directors, elected by full members, and will serve a four-year term beginning July 1, 2026, and concluding on June 30, 2030. About the Urban Land Institute:

The Urban Land Institute is a nonprofit education and research institute supported by its members. Its mission is to shape the future of the built environment for transformative impact in communities worldwide. Established in 1936, the institute has more than 45,000 members worldwide representing all aspects of land use and development disciplines.
